Moderators Gregory Matthews Posted March 16, 2022 Moderators Posted March 16, 2022 My purpose is to provide a listing of Internet websites that have a focus on the SDA church. Some will provide news as to what is currently happening in Adventism. Some will provide a forum where people can discuss whatever they wish to discuss that is related to Adventism. Some will reflect issues from the standpoint of what is considered orthodox and others will be seen as challenging is some respect aspects of Adventism. My intent is to not list websites that I personally consider to be primarily negative toward the SDA church. So, there are plenty of websites that I will not list. In each case I will give a short statement as to my thinking about the website. It has about 1,300 members and it is quite conservative in its approach to Adventism. https://adventistan.com/forums/ This is an independent forum that was begun many years ago by two employees of the Canadian Union Conference and one employee of the General Conference. It has some 12,500 plus members. About 1/3 are traditional SDA members, 1/3, non-traditional SDA members and 1/3 people who are not SDA members in any sense. It is similar to Adventist Today and Spectrum which are located in the United States. http://sdanet.org/ This is a large and important website that contains links to many sources of information about the SDA Church. https://www.adventistbiblicalresearch.org/ I consider the Biblical Research Institute to be a very valuable source of information that is little known by most SDA members. It publishes a newsletter that is free to all who wish to receive it. It publishes books of value. It speaks to controversial issues in Adventism. https://blog.feedspot.com/adventist_bloggs/ This website lists some 40 Internet websites devoted to Adventism, most of which discuss the SDA form of Adventism.
